Regenstech was founded in 2019 with a very clear goal:
to become the leading technological solution for
transforming textile and fashion
waste into new secondary raw materials.

MARIA SILVIA PAZZI
CEO & FOUNDER
Pioneer of sustainable fashion. 18 years ago, inspired by her blacksmith grandfather and seamstress grandmother — and committed to leaving a better world for the next generation — Maria Silvia founded Regenesi to reimagine how fashion is made, then Regenstech to make technology the enabler of that vision. Today she contributes to the Board of CNA and FIDAPA BPW, and regularly brings the real world into the classroom at the University of Bologna

ALFREDO MONTANARI
MD & CO-FOUNDER
Seasoned executive turned full-time entrepreneur. Alfredo built his career leading HR and Operations at Vodafone, Seat Pagine Gialle, Datalogic, and Bologna Business School — always alongside his role as co-founder of Regenesi and Regenstech. Today, as co-founder and Managing Director of both Regenesi and Regenstech where he holds a minority stake — he is fully focused on scaling circular economy solutions for fashion and textile, shaping both companies around a generative hub model: organizations that create value through relationships. RECOGNITIONS IN OUR JOURNEY TOWARDS SUSTAINABILITY
2025
Winner of Green Chain Award at the MF Value Chain Awards 2025, held during the Milano Fashion Global Summit.
Winner of Circular Economy Award at the CNMI Sustainable Fashion Awards, organized by the Camera Nazionale della Moda Italiana and the UN Alliance for Sustainable Fashion.
FIDAPA BPW Italy International Award – Women Innovators: Shaping a Sustainable Future – winner in the category “Women Start-Up Entrepreneurs”.
Regenesi was selected among the 100 Italian companies featured in the campaign Artisanship: The Future of Made in Italy by Fondazione Symbola.
Regenstech wins the Call4Ideas – Energy and Digital Transition launched by Eni Joule and Accenture Italy.
2024
Regenesi is selected among the 100 Success Stories in the Circular Economy Report by the Circular Economy Observatory of POLIMI – School of Management.
Maria Silvia Pazzi wins the B-Factor Award from the Marisa Bellisario Foundation.
2023
Regenesi is selected among Forbes’ 100 Sustainability Champions.
Maria Silvia Pazzi wins the Women At The Top Award, part of the Open Innovation category promoted by Il Sole 24 Ore, Financial Times, and Sky TG24.
2022
Regenesi wins the Sustainable Fashion Award at the Monte Carlo Fashion Week.
From 2021
Maria Silvia Pazzi is recognized among the “50 Unstoppable Women”.
2019
Regenesi is among the first selected as Green Heroes, an initiative by Alessandro Gassman with Annalisa Corrado and the scientific support of Kyoto Club.
Regenesi wins the “Best Performer Circular Economy” award promoted by Confindustria, Enel X, and LUISS Business School, and the “Best Inventor and Best Innovator in Italy” award promoted by ITWIIN.
2018
Regenesi is selected among the “100 Italian Stories of Circular Economy”, a report published by Enel and Fondazione Symbola.
2017
Regenesi wins the “Responsible Innovators” award from the Emilia-Romagna Region and hosts the first TedX on Sustainability in Italy during the G7 Environment
REPETTO ATELIER AT ORANGERIE, RAVENNA ITALY
Regenstech’s Atelier and Application Show Room is now part of Orangerie — a 7,000 m² circular ecosystem on Ravenna’s Darsena di Città, shared with Regenesi and open to the city.
Technology, design, and regeneration under one roof. The work is real. The doors will be open soon.
